Region de Murcia International Airport is a Spanish airport situated in the Region of Murcia, on the eastern side of the country. It sits at an elevation of 646 feet and offers a single long hard-surfaced runway, making it a straightforward reference point for VFR pilots transiting or arriving in the area.
Region de Murcia International Airport (ICAO: RMU) is located in the Region de Murcia, Spain, at an elevation of 646 feet above mean sea level. It is built around a single physical runway aligned 05/23 with a hard, lit surface.
The airport lies at coordinates 37.8057N, 1.1287W in the Region de Murcia, Spain.
The field has one physical runway, aligned 05/23, of hard surface and lit. The 05 direction is listed at 9839 feet in length, while the reciprocal 23 direction is listed at 5245 feet, reflecting differing declared distances for each direction of use. There is no ILS available at this runway.
